The Department of Computer Science, your home for four years or so, is celebrating its 26th Anniversary. As a member of this family, we invite you to come home to see and experience the CS life as we have it today.The Department has gone through a
number of changes — from ES to ECS to CS, from a few lecture rooms to a new building, from ‘the youngest department’ to ’one of the best departments’ in Engineering, from paper to online submission of academic requirements, from a
few Radio Shack TRS 80’s running TRSDOS and Basic to fully-equipped laboratories
running the latest software. Indeed we have gone through exciting transformations, but still we are the same CS Department that you know.

With 5 Outstanding Engineering Faculty awardees among our faculty members, with 7 Engineering Class Valedictorians, 2 Summa, 40 Magna and 121 Cum Laudes among our 1047 graduates (so far), with several BPI Science, P&G Excellence, and Undergraduate Research Competition winners among our students, and a curriculum that is constantly reviewed and revised to adapt to the dynamic discipline we are in, we keep alive the tradition of excellence that has always been the hallmark of our Department. With 22 CS Week celebrations, annual freshmen orientation and department-sponsored events and competitions, with the newly instituted Mentoring Program and GeeCS for academic-related activities, we continually strive to keep our students well-rounded as well.
